Forbes Field was located in the Oakland neighborhood of Pittsburgh Pennsylvania and played host to the Pittsburgh Pirates (MLB) and Steelers (NFL) as well as the University of Pittsburgh Panthers. The stadium was built in 1909 and was demolished in 1971 when construction of Three Rivers Stadium began. At the time it was the second oldest ballpark to Philadelphia's Shibe Park.

Important Dates:In 1909 Forbes Field's opening season the Pirates beat the Detroit Tigers in the World Series. It would be the only meeting of eventual Hall of Famers Honus Wagner and Ty Cobb.On August 5 1921 Forbes Field was the site of the first live radio broadcast of a Major League Baseball game in the United States.On May 25 1935 at Forbes Field Babe Ruth hit the last three home runs of his career as his Boston Braves lost to the Pirates 11-7. His last home run cleared the right field stands roofline making him the first player to ever do so.

Offered is a single grandstand chair once used at the famed Steel City ballpark. The chair is comprised of a three-panel wooden back rest and a wooden folding seat within a sturdy metal frame with armrests. A vintage coat of blue paint has worn severely in several areas most notably on the upper back slat and front seat slat. Rust is apparent on portions of the metallic elements however the seat is sturdy and retains a great vintage look.

Includes a Letter of Provenance from The Newport Sports Museum.
